Setup

1. Loading Rounds

  1. Locate the side-loading internal magazine on the blaster.
  2. Insert the 12 Official Nerf Rival rounds one by one into the magazine until it is full.

2. Priming the Blaster

  1. Grasp the priming bolt located on the top of the blaster.
  2. Pull the priming bolt all the way back until it clicks into place.
  3. Push the priming bolt forward to prepare the blaster for firing.

Operating the Blaster

Firing a Round

  1. Ensure the blaster is loaded and primed.
  2. Disengage the trigger lock (if engaged). The trigger lock is a small switch near the trigger.
  3. Aim the blaster at your target.
  4. Press the trigger to fire one round.

Utilizing the Curve Shot Feature

The Sideswipe XXI-1200 Blaster features a rotating muzzle that allows you to adjust the trajectory of your shots.

  1. Locate the rotating muzzle at the front of the blaster.
  2. Turn the muzzle to select your desired curve:
    • Left Curve: Rotate the muzzle to direct rounds to curve left.
    • Right Curve: Rotate the muzzle to direct rounds to curve right.
    • Straight Shot: Align the muzzle for a straight trajectory.
    • Downward Curve: Rotate the muzzle to direct rounds to curve downward.
  3. Once the desired curve is set, aim and fire as usual.

Troubleshooting

ProblemPossible CauseSolution
Blaster not firing or rounds not launching with full power.
  • Blaster not fully primed.
  • Trigger lock engaged.
  • Deformed or unofficial rounds.
  • Magazine jammed or obstructed.
  • Ensure the priming bolt is pulled back and pushed forward completely until it clicks.
  • Disengage the trigger lock.
  • Use only Official Nerf Rival rounds. Replace any damaged rounds.
  • Check the magazine and barrel for obstructions and clear them carefully.
Rounds not curving as expected.
  • Muzzle not correctly rotated.
  • Rounds are worn or damaged.
  • Ensure the muzzle is rotated to the desired curve setting (left, right, or down).
  • Use new, official Nerf Rival rounds for optimal performance.
